target/haiku-softpipe: Fix viewport issues

* Call mesa viewport call on winndow resize
* Add initial postprocessing code
* Pass hgl_context to private statetracker
  as it is more useful than GalliumContext
* Use Lock and Unlock functions to standardize
  GalliumContext locking
* Create texture resources in texture validation

Acked-by: Brian Paul <brianp@vmware.com>
